The reason you feel your ankles/calves load more in spikes is because spiked shoes act as "jumpsoles". Meaning - the spike length in the front part of the foot creates a forefoot loaded walk/run mechanics and the heel will be in the air if the foot is parallel to the ground.
So they basically act like "shorter jumpsoles", making that one additional benefit of spiked shoes.
